@charset "utf-8";
/* CSS Document */


.clear-div-z {clear:both}

#banner-zatarn {width:656px; height:251px; margin:0 0 0 15px; background: url(../images-zatarn/banner2_02.png) top center no-repeat; position:relative}
.bn-zatarn {width:615px; height:179px; margin:0 auto; }
.bn-zatarn a {width:615px; height:179px;}
.bn-zatarn a img {border:#666 1px solid; margin-top:3px}
.bn-zatarn a span { font-size:11px; width:600px; color:#333; display:block; margin:4px 0 0 10px}
.bn-zatarn a:hover span {font-size:11px; left:0px; color:#999}

.bn-zatarn-top {position:absolute; bottom:3px; left:15px; width:300px; margin-left:10px }
.bn-zatarn-top li {text-align:center; float:left; display:block;}
.bn-zatarn-top a {width:13px; height:13px; font-size:13px; color:#FFF; text-align:center; float:left; display:block; margin:3px 3px 0 0; padding:2px; line-height:10px; text-decoration:none}
.bn-zatarn-top a:hover {width:13px; height:13px; background:#FFF; font-size:13px; color:#030; text-align:center; float:left; display:block; margin:3px 3px 0 0; padding:2px ; line-height:10px;  text-decoration:none}


.abs-left-z {position:absolute; top:0px; left:0px}
.abs-right-z {position:absolute; top:0px; right:0p; left: 638px;}



#zone1_z {width:1003; margin:0 auto; background-color:#FFF}
#zone-pet-z {width:247px; float:left; display:inline; background:url(../images/pet_01.jpg) top center no-repeat;}
.pet-box {text-align:center; font-size:11px; text-decoration:none;  padding:0 0 0 0;}
.pet-box a {color:#060; }
.pet-box a:hover {color: #09F;}

.pic-text {font-size:12px;text-decoration:none; text-decoration:none; margin: 0 auto}
.pic-text {width:243px; text-decoration:none; } 
.pic-text img { display:block; width:233px; margin:5px 0 0 5px}
.pic-text span a {width:210px; display:block; margin:0 auto; padding:2px 10px ; color:#360; border:#FFF 1px solid; background:#b7e25e; }
.pic-text span a:hover {color:#03C; border:#FFF 1px solid background:#b7e25e;}

.pet-box-1 {width:231px; margin:0 auto}
.pet-box-1 li {margin:3px 0 0 0; width:231px; overflow:hidden; }
.pet-box-1 li img {float:left; display:inline; border:#360 1px solid;}
.pet-box-1 li a img {float:left; display:inline; border:#360 1px solid;}
.pet-box-1 li a:hover img {float:left; display:inline; border: #F36 1px solid;}
.pet-box-1 li span a {float:left; display:inline; width:160px; padding-left:2px; color:#060;}
.pet-box-1 li span a:hover {float:left; display:inline; width:160px; padding-left:2px; color:#03F;}

.center-zatarn { margin:0 auto; width:1003px}
.footpet { background: url(../images/pet_02.jpg) top center no-repeat; color:#FFF; text-align:center; height:27px; padding-top:4px;}
.footpet a { color:#FFF}
.footpet a:hover { color: #FF0}

#fg1 {width:389px; height:440px; float:left; display:inline; background:url(../images/bg-fg.jpg) top center no-repeat;}
.fb-game {width:350px; margin:10px 0 0 20px}
.fb-game li { width:100px; height:115px; float:left; display:block; text-align:center; margin:0 0 10px 13px; font-size:11px}
.fb-game li a {color:#333}
.fb-game li a:hover {color:#03F}

.dara-fb {width:360px; margin:0 0 0 18px; display:block}
.dara-fb li { float:left; display:inline; margin:3px 0 0 3px}

.fb-msn {width:367px; float:left; display:inline;}
.tw-z {background:url(../images-zatarn/guide-FB_01.jpg) top center no-repeat; height:81px; font-size:12px; padding:10px 15px 0 120px}
.tw-z a {color:#333} 
.tw-z a strong {color:#06F;} 
.tw-z a:hover {color:#000;} 
.tw-z a:hover strong { color: #36F;} 

.ih-z {background:url(../images-zatarn/guide-FB_02.jpg) top center no-repeat; height:102px; font-size:12px; padding:10px 15px 0 120px}
.ih-z a {color:#333} 
.ih-z a strong {color: #060;} 
.ih-z a:hover {color:#000;} 
.ih-z a:hover strong {color:#690;} 


.hot-event-ztop { width:817; height:26px; margin-left:10px; background:url(../images-zatarn/hoteventhead2.jpg) top center no-repeat; font-size:11px; color:#333; line-height:26px; text-align: right; padding-right:30px}
.hot-event-ztop a { color:#333}
.hot-event-ztop a:hover {color:#090}


.hot-event-z { width:800; margin-left:10px}
.hot-event-z li {width:200px; background:#ececec; float:left; display:inline; margin:0 3px 10px 0 ; overflow:hidden }
.hot-event-z li img {float:left; margin:5px}
.hot-event-z li span {width:138px; float:left; display:block; font-size:11px; margin-top:5px}
.hot-event-z li span a {color:#333;}
.hot-event-z li span a:hover {color:#060;}

.news-promote {width:330px; height:250px; margin-left:5px; float:left; display:inline; border:#999 1px solid}
.news-promote li {width:160px; height:60px; float:left; display:inline; overflow:hidden; padding:3px 0 0 3px; font-size:11px}
.news-promote li img {float:left; margin-right:3px}

.news-promote li strong {font-size:12px; color:#090}
.news-promote li a strong {color:#090}
.news-promote li a:hover strong {color:#090}

.news-promote li a   {color:#999}
.news-promote li a:hover   {color:#C00}


.menu-top-z {width:162px; height:30px; font-size:12px; color:#333; text-align:center;}

.menu-z 					{width:162px; background:url(../images-zatarn/menu-zatarn_02.gif) top center repeat-y}
.menu-z ul 					{margin-left:4px;}
.menu-z li 					{width:154px; background:url(../images-zatarn/bg.jpg) bottom center no-repeat; border-bottom:#CCC 1px dashed} 
.menu-z li a 				{height:30px; display:block; overflow:hidden; color:#333; width:154px}
.menu-z li a img 			{margin-left:3px; float:left; display:inline;}
.menu-z li a strong 		{font-size:12px; color:#666; font-weight:normal;  padding:10px 0 0 0; display:block}
.menu-z li a span 			{width:102px; font-size:11px; display:block; padding:15px 0 0 0}

.menu-z li a:hover        	{width:154px; height:85px; text-decoration:none; color:#F39}
.menu-z li a:hover img   	{margin-left:3px; float:left; display:inline; padding:20px 0 0 0}
.menu-z li a:hover strong 	{font-size:12px; color:#090; font-weight:bold; font-size:14px; display:block; margin-left:50px;  padding:15px 0 0 0; }
.menu-z li a:hover span   	{width:102px; font-size:11px; display:block; margin-left:50px; padding:0 0 0 0; color:#666 }

#menuleft-z { width:162px; margin-left:6px; display:inline; }
.top-z {width:162; height:21px; text-align:center; font-size:11px; background:url(../images-zatarn/bgmenu.jpg) top center no-repeat; padding-top:10px}











